Puerto Pollensa is a small, quiet town in northern Mallorca, approximately 5 miles from Pollensa and 7 miles from Alcudia.
The town is a popular tourist destination because of its relaxed atmosphere and laid-back nightlife. It is an excellent place for those seeking a romantic break with plenty of bars and restaurants creating a welcoming atmosphere for visitors.
Puerto Pollensa’s Mediterranean climate enjoys hot summers and mild winters. In addition, the weather provides ideal summer temperatures for lounging on the beach or watching as the elegant yachts come in and out of the marina.

Puerto Pollensa is a small Mallorcan town that is located northeast of the capital city of Palma, and is one of the furthest holiday resorts from Mallorca Palma Airport.
This longer transfer time compared to many of the other resorts on the island makes it relatively quiet, which is perfect for those seeking a relaxing break in Mallorca. Although the town is more peaceful than the others, it still offers guests a well-established resort set in a sweeping bay with lots of land and water activities.
The town of Puerto Pollensa isn’t well-known for having lively nightlife, but there are still several great bars and restaurants to enjoy a drink in a cosy atmosphere. Alongside this, the marina at Puerto Pollensa provides visitors with a classy experience, surrounded by super-yachts and many high-end shops and bars.

Dating back as far as 2000 BC, the beautiful Mallorcan village of Calvià is a traditional and rural location for those looking to experience a more tranquil side of the popular Balearic island destination. Nestled in the southwest of the island, on the foothills of the Tramuntana mountain range, the village is ideally located near some of Mallorca’s most popular attractions, beach resorts and cities.
